The Grateful Dead
Thursday, September 12th, 1991
Madison Square Garden
New York City, NY
Disc One:
1. Tuning
2. Hell in a Bucket
3. Bertha
4. Walking Blues
5. Ramble on Rose
6. Beat it on Down the Line >
7. Big Railroad Blues
8. Just Like Tom Thumb's Blues
9. Let it Grow
Disc Two:
1. Tuning
2. Sugar Magnolia >
3. Foolish Heart >
4. Playin' in the Band >
5. Terrapin Station >
6. Playin' jam >
7. Drumz >
Disc Three:
1. Space >
2. The Wheel >
3. Black Peter >
4. Around n' Around >
5. Sunshine Daydream
6. Box of Rain
The pedigree for this tape is soundboard > DAT > CDR > SHN
according to Tiedrich's Tapes in Circulation page.
All you alert Beatles fans will note the "I Want to Tell You"
tease in the tune-up before Sugar Magnolia
Notes:
- I recut this show. Some of the cuts were slightly off and there
was 3 minutes of tuning prior to Sugar Magnolia.
- Just before "We'll be Back" there was a dropout. 00:01.796 was cut
out.
- Dropout in Foolish Heart repaired. It occurs around 1 minute into
the song. 00:00.12 was cut out.
- Between Drums and Space there was 00:00.603 of silence. I cut this
out to make d2 and d3 seemless.
- Between Sunshine Daydream and the encore there was a tiny skip. I
cut out 00:00.045 to make it a bit more seemless.
- Many pops and clicks taken out. Complete list in info file that comes with this set.
